How they compare

OECD (EI) currently reports 1,631 terawatt-hours against 216.88 terawatt-hours in Indonesia, a difference of 1,414 terawatt-hours.

That makes OECD (EI)'s figure about 7.5 times Indonesia's.

Across all 61 years both countries report, OECD (EI) has been ahead every year.

Indonesia ranks 3rd and OECD (EI) ranks 1st of 79 countries.

OECD (EI) has averaged higher in every one of the 7 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Indonesia OECD (EI) Difference Ahead
1960s 0 terawatt-hours 92.64 terawatt-hours 92.64 terawatt-hours OECD (EI)
1970s 0 terawatt-hours 149.32 terawatt-hours 149.32 terawatt-hours OECD (EI)
1980s 0 terawatt-hours 318.05 terawatt-hours 318.05 terawatt-hours OECD (EI)
1990s 20.46 terawatt-hours 591.72 terawatt-hours 571.27 terawatt-hours OECD (EI)
2000s 68.02 terawatt-hours 848.71 terawatt-hours 780.7 terawatt-hours OECD (EI)
2010s 117.41 terawatt-hours 1,360 terawatt-hours 1,242 terawatt-hours OECD (EI)
2020s 218.89 terawatt-hours 1,608 terawatt-hours 1,389 terawatt-hours OECD (EI)

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
